Wooden Veranda Construction Questions
What materials are used for wooden verandas? Common materials include pressure-treated lumber, cedar, and redwood, chosen for durability and appearance.
Can a wooden veranda be customized to match existing structures? Yes, designs can be tailored to complement the style and layout of existing outdoor spaces.
What maintenance is needed for a wooden veranda? Regular sealing, staining, and inspection help maintain its appearance and structural integrity.
